You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
TD-er 338578dd96
[P020_Ser2Net] Fix missing break; PLUGIN_SERIAL_IN
1 day ago
.github Added checklist to the Issue_template 1 year ago
dist automatically updated release notes for mega-20200328 1 week ago
docs Merge pull request #2950 from TD-er/feature/I2C_uart_serial 2 weeks ago
hooks add missing & around value 2 years ago
lib [Serial Proxy] Use capture filtering 2 weeks ago
misc [LoRa/TTN] Add decoder for the packet header 7 months ago
patches Support for MITSUBISHI KJ heatpumps (SG 161 0927 remote) 6 months ago
src [P020_Ser2Net] Fix missing break; PLUGIN_SERIAL_IN 1 day ago
static Minify the JS code + store in flash 1 month ago
test [benchmark] fixed incorrect syntax 1 month ago
tools [Vagrant] Sample pio_envlist.txt file 4 months ago
.atom-build.yml fixed custom build path 2 years ago
.gitignore [Vagrant] Sample pio_envlist.txt file 4 months ago
.gitmodules now no longer a submodule. lib/IRremoteESP8266 upstream version v1.0.2 2 years ago
.travis.yml [Build] Disable test_ESP8266_4M1M_VCC_MDNS_SD due to max sketch size 2 weeks ago
License.txt Webgui with menu 4 years ago
README add missing & around value, add README 2 years ago
README.md [README] updated with link to ICONS8 3 months ago
before_deploy [Commands] Adapt all plugins to use parseString for parsing commands 4 months ago
crc2.py [fix for crc2.py] truncation corrupted bin file 1 year ago
embed_files.sh [Embed Files] Avoid redirect http to https of minify_html_css 1 year ago
esp32_partition_app1310k_spiffs1503k.csv [ESP32] Add default partition table for reference 1 year ago
esp32_partition_app1810k_spiffs316k.csv [ESP32] Change partition size (will clear all settings) and add plugins 1 year ago
memanalyzer.py [PIO] Add core 2.6.1 SDK3 builds and PIO env list for Vagrant 4 months ago
platformio.ini [PIO] Split platformio.ini into separate files + cleanup. 4 months ago
platformio_core_defs.ini [PIO] Use platform_packages for all core libs supporting those 1 week ago
platformio_esp32_envs.ini [ESP32] Make sure to include the version tag in ESPEasySerial libdeb 2 weeks ago
platformio_esp82xx_base.ini [PIO] Use platform_packages for all core libs supporting those 1 week ago
platformio_esp82xx_envs.ini [PIO] Use platform_packages for all core libs supporting those 1 week ago
platformio_special_envs.ini [PIO] Use platform_packages for all core libs supporting those 1 week ago
pre_custom_esp32.py [PIO] Update to core 2.6.2 4 months ago
pre_custom_esp82xx.py [Cron] Fix memory leak 1 month ago
pre_default_check.py [PIO] Don't use Python 3 specific since Travis still uses Python 2.7 4 months ago
pre_memanalyze.py [Build] Fix use of flag BUILD_NO_DEBUG 6 months ago
preflight.sh [Docs] Disable travis_terminate for now 1 year ago
release Spelling correction 1 year ago
releasebot fixed releasebot issues with multiple branches 2 years ago
requirements.txt [Cleanup] Split settings from global.h into separate .h and .cpp 7 months ago
uncrustify.cfg [Uncrustify] Move uncrustify.cfg to project dir 8 months ago

README.md

Latest Nightly Build Status Downloads Docs Patreon Ko-Fi PayPal
GitHub version Build Status Downloads Documentation Status donate donate donate

For ways to support us, see this announcement on the forum, or have a look at the Patreon, Ko-Fi or PayPal links above.

ESPEasy (development branch)

Introduction and wiki: https://www.letscontrolit.com/wiki/index.php/ESPEasy#Introduction

MEGA :warning:This is the development branch of ESPEasy. All new untested features go into this branch. If you want to do a bugfix, do it on the stable branch, we will merge the fix to the development branch as well.:warning:

Check here to learn how to use this branch and help us improving ESPEasy: http://www.letscontrolit.com/wiki/index.php/ESPEasy#Source_code_development

Automated binary releases

Every night our build-bot will build a new binary release: https://github.com/letscontrolit/ESPEasy/releases

The releases are named something like ‘mega-20190225’ (last number is the build date)

Depending on your needs, we release different types of files:

Firmware name Hardware Included plugins
ESPEasy_mega-20190225_normal_ESP8266_1M.bin ESP8266 with 1MB flash Stable
ESPEasy_mega-20190225_test_ESP8266_1M.bin ESP8266 with 1MB flash Stable + Test
ESPEasy_mega-20190225_dev_ESP8266_1M.bin ESP8266 with 1MB flash Stable + Test + Development
ESPEasy_mega-20190225_normal_ESP8266_4M.bin ESP8266 with 4MB flash Stable
ESPEasy_mega-20190225_test_ESP8266_4M.bin ESP8266 with 4MB flash Stable + Test
ESPEasy_mega-20190225_dev_ESP8266_4M.bin ESP8266 with 4MB flash Stable + Test + Development
ESPEasy_mega-20190225_normal_ESP8285_1M.bin ESP8285 with 1MB flash Stable
ESPEasy_mega-20190225_test_ESP8285_1M.bin ESP8285 with 1MB flash Stable + Test
ESPEasy_mega-20190225_dev_ESP8285_1M.bin ESP8285 with 1MB flash Stable + Test + Development

More info

Details and discussion are on the “Experimental” section of the forum: https://www.letscontrolit.com/forum/viewforum.php?f=18

Automated builds of the (new) documentation can be found at ESPEasy.readthedocs.io

Icons used

Icons on courtesy of ICONS8.